| Description: | Artificial insemination is the reproductive biotechnology with the highest contribution to the cattle breeding. This would not be possible without the success of sperm cryopreservation. However, cryopreservation causes sperm cell alterations, modifying the general metabolism. The objective of this study was to compare different methods for sperm assessment, in order to find the best strategy of analysis and thus provide reliable parameters for the inspection of bovine semen imported to Brazil. |
